本人虽然学校校招机会多,但自己编程知识不扎实,后端有点劝退我了,加之对android开发感兴趣,这整个阶段就一直在准备android的面试,听大家说去哪儿旅游的福利待遇还不错,整场面试下来自己感觉也OK,所以还是建议大家积极参加去哪儿的面试,问的题目中规中矩,并不太难(也可以是我没啥对口的项目可问,哈哈),但是大家还是多练习,对android相关知识足够熟悉的话,什么面试都不在话下,我的面经仅供大
我走的内推,和HR姐姐聊的时候,正好问到有部门要招Android开发,不过要去实习,我也参加了面试,题量不大,在之前的实习这块聊得比较细,项目对答这种,实习认真参与了的话肯定没啥问题,其他部分的话还是一些基础题,这个对我难度不大,还是相对比较轻松的那种。 项目介绍(在开发中遇到了什么问题,最后是如何解决的,项目中接触最多的部分是什么?性能优化部分具体讲讲) Arraylist和Linkedlist
技术面 项目介绍(在开发中遇到了什么问题,最后是如何解决的) Java面向对象的认识 数组和链表的区别 接口和抽象类的区别,它们各自的使用场景 安卓的四大组件 Activity生命周期,跳转其他Activity startService与bindService的区别 HashMap底层原理 HashMap和HashTable的区别 内存优化 进程和线程的区别 进程间通信的方式 HTTPS的建立过程
我正在尝试解决下面的图形练习: 在一个无向加权图中,有V个顶点和E条边。从标记为0的顶点开始,求访问T(T<=v)个顶点所需的最小权值。另外,如果两个被访问的顶点之间存在边,则其权重设置为0。 编辑:我给你举个例子。假设我们有一个图,有4个顶点,标记为0,1,2和3。我们有以下边(from,to,weight):(0,1,1)(0,2,2)(1,3,4)(2,3,1)最小生成树将包含边:(0,1,
我的json是{[{“key1”:“value1”,“key2”:“valu2”},{“key3”:“value3”,“key4”:“valu4”}]} 如何将上面的文字修改如下。谢谢你帮助我的朋友 {"travel": [{"key1":"value1 "," key 2 ":" value 2 " },{ key3":"value3 "," key4":"value4}]}
用 PHP 作为我们「Docker 开发大礼包」开篇是带着一些朝圣的心情的。这是一门堪称「古老」的语言,也是一门争议最多的语言,更是一门不断涅槃的语言。「PHP 是最好的语言」这个流传已久的梗,或许正是对我国最有群众基础的编程语言描述里,最经典的注解。 就让我们一起回顾一下 PHP 的发展历程作为此系列文章的开篇。历史是最好的老师,他给每个未来提供启示。 谁创造了 PHP? Rasmus Lerd
Tornado 是由 Facebook 开源的一个服务器“套装”,适合于做 python 的 web 或者使用其本身提供的可扩展的功能,完成了不完整的 wsgi 协议,可用于做快速的 web 开发,封装了 epoll 性能较好。文章主要以分析 tornado 的网络部分即异步事件处理与上层的 IOstream 类提供的异步IO,其他的模块如 web 的 tornado.web 以后慢慢留作分析。
我看同程也没人写,刚面的热乎的 一面 10.11 0.自我介绍 1.介绍实习,测试流程,自动化流程,白盒流程,接口迁移流程 2.讲一下数据库索引(讲太多被打断了说可以了),select *和select xxx有啥区别 3.接口传输方式哪些,get和post区别 4.如果接口返回过慢如何定位 5.如何看日志过滤关键字 6.你的springboot项目端口号默认是多少,是否使用了容器 7.如果端口被
周一在boss上投了一个同程旅行的运维岗,给对应部门看完简历后,周二hr就给我安排了一面试。 周三上午一面:实习工作内容,实习中学习到什么,接触到什么 对于运维岗过程中遇到的问题怎么去排查的 对于devops的理解 项目发版发布的流程 项目中的问题 k8s的环境的一些问题 反问了一些业务的问题,涉及到技术栈,工作内容。 基本上就是这些,都流畅的回答出来了。面试完成之后hr下午就告诉我一面通过了,给
#航旅纵横# Java后端 自我介绍一下包括项目,校园经历等等 🤔 面试感受 1,对简历里面的项目,实习等内容问问 2,排序的算法都有哪些 3,synchronized和threadlocal 4,自定义线程池 5,git命令 6,MySQL三中删表方式 7,MySQL索引的种类和实现方式 8,spring的aop和IOC 9,对Redis了解?具体哪些 10,hashcode和equals 1
45min 强度很大,面试官全程围绕简历和项目深挖,差点就没顶住😭 不过面试官人很好,我卡壳的地方会引导,我不会的或者说的不对的也会给出正确的解答 自我介绍 挑一个你比较熟悉的项目讲讲(硬着头皮选了组件库,噩梦开始) 组件库如何打包的配置脚手架(command-line-usage插件处理用户参数balabala之类的) 脚手架中拉取远程模板怎么做的,还有别的方法吗? 有做对脚手架复杂逻辑的处理
Timeline: 9.1 投递 9.14 笔试 9.25 一面 11.1 二面 技术+HR面 9.25 一面 23min: 1.项目经历 2.数仓分层 3.数仓执行引擎 4.Sql关键字执行顺序 5.Mysql索引引擎 6.Innodb和myisam区别 7.Flink基本算子 8.Map和flatmap 9.Keyby 10.数据倾斜 怎么定位 11.Hive分区表和非分区表 12.增加或删
问题内容: 我想通过Node.js矩模块获得纽约和香港之间的时差。我已经做了一些初步的工作。 然后,我可以继续编写一个函数,以小时为单位计算两个时区之间的时差。我希望有一个更简单的方法。 矩型库中有更优雅,更简单的方法吗? 问题答案: 不确定“更简单”,但更正确(因为并非所有时区都相隔一个小时):
本文向大家介绍Boosting/Bagging 与 偏差/方差 的关系相关面试题,主要包含被问及Boosting/Bagging 与 偏差/方差 的关系时的应答技巧和注意事项,需要的朋友参考一下 Boosting 能提升弱分类器性能的原因是降低了偏差;Bagging 则是降低了方差; 偏差与方差分别是用于衡量一个模型泛化误差的两个方面; 模型的偏差,指的是模型预测的期望值与真实值之间的差; 模型的
除了期望,方差(variance)是另一个常见的分布描述量。如果说期望表示的是分布的中心位置,那么方差就是分布的离散程度。方差越大,说明随机变量取值越离散。 比如射箭时,一个优秀的选手能保持自己的弓箭集中于目标点附近,而一个经验不足的选手,他弓箭的落点会更容易散落许多地方。 上面的靶上有两套落点。尽管两套落点的平均中心位置都在原点 (即期望相同),但两套落点的离散程度明显有区别。蓝色的点离散程度更